About VET.CA

Company Profile

VET logo image Vermilion Energy, Inc. engages in the acquisition, exploration, development, and production of oil and natural gas. The company is headquartered in Calgary, Alberta and currently employs 743 full-time employees. The firm seeks to create value through the acquisition, exploration, development, and optimization of producing assets in North America, Europe, and Australia. Its geographical segments include Canada, USA, France, Netherlands, Germany, Ireland, Australia, and Central & Eastern Europe (CEE). Its operations are focused on the exploitation of light oil and liquids-rich natural gas conventional and unconventional resource plays in North America and the exploration and development of conventional natural gas and oil opportunities in Europe and Australia. Its Canadian production and assets are focused on West Pembina near Drayton Valley, Alberta, in the Peace River Arch in northeast British Columbia and northwest Alberta and in southeast Saskatchewan and southwest Manitoba. Its assets in France are located in Aquitaine and Paris Basins. In Netherlands, its producing assets are located in the northwest part of the country.
